The asbestos shoes are most likely going to be much more durable than what you get off the shelf these days. All the cracked shoes I have seen were less expensive types. your drums may be geting thin, and/or the drums coudl have hard spots. Hard spots look like fish eye in the drum. when you try to machine them you end up with little bumps all over. The only way to get rid of them is to replace drum or reverse cut them on a brake laithe, by manualy cutting the drum inward. (a trick I learned from an old guy)
